Love Working With People? Here are 5 Top Careers to Consider

On average, Britons spend 1,791 hours every year working.

If anything, the sheer chunk of your life spent working is incentive enough to ensure you pick a career you will thrive in, and that you will absolutely love.

One thing you should think about is whether you love working with people, or if you prefer working by yourself behind a computer in a quiet office.

If you love being around people, you are in luck, as you are about to discover some of the top careers that will allow you to be around people throughout your working days.

1. Teaching

As a teacher, the best part of your working days will be filled with student interactions.

Aside from being around students, you will also be in the company of other teachers and at times, parents.

If you particularly love the idea of nurturing young minds and are drawn to people, this should be a top consideration.

If you opt to teach students at more advanced levels, you might find the interactions even more enjoyable and fulfilling.

2. Human Resource Management

As the title suggests, this job is all about people.

Successful HR practitioners tend to be people-centred professionals with well-developed social skills.

On a day to day, HR professionals handle, screening and interviewing and orientation of new hires. All these require a lot of person-to-person interaction.

They also handle employee relations, discipline and employee welfare. These roles require an approachable person, as well as one that is able to make fair judgements of situations.

3. Cabin Crew

This is a perfect choice for people that love travel and mixing with a diverse set of people.

Airlines tend to seek out candidates that are extroverted, approachable, energetic and attentive,

In this role, you will do flight reports, serve food and drink on board as well as handle any customer issues on board.

In essence, ensure all passengers are well taken care of and comfortable for the duration of their flight.

In the course of your work, you will meet all sorts of different people, and temperaments from all over the world. And maybe even exchange some interesting stories with them.

4. Sales Representatives

Sales reps sell products on behalf of manufacturers and wholesalers.

The major part of their jobs entails meeting prospective clients and taking them through the products on sale, hoping to convert them into customers.

To execute this on the day to day, you have to be an excellent communicator, be friendly, knowledgeable and sociable.

Being a people’s person will certainly make this easier.

5. Events Planner

Event Planners plan and execute functions and are, therefore, almost always surrounded by people.

These include clients, suppliers, transporters, entertainers, caterers, and so on.

Your people skills and your general love for people will come in handy when trying to understand what a client needs. This might require you to listen to what they say as well as what they don’t.

Your people skills will also come in handy when negotiating rates on behalf of your client.

Every aspect of this job will be people-centred, and your success will be highly dependent on how well you can build a rapport with both clients and other players.
